ACTi Releases New Version of MobileGo!

Monday, May 16th, 2011

The latest iPhone APP release from ACTi is available now. The MobileGo! APP enables users of ACTi IP cameras to easily control and monitor their security cameras from Apple devices such as the iPhone, iPad and iPod.

The MobileGo! Application boasts effortless control with any Apple device on the 3G or WiFi networks, allowing ACTi IP camera users to view live camera feeds virtually from anywhere. Some of the many great features available to users include: Pan, Tilt and Zoom control; 640 x 480 resolution; Live view; Image Playback; and, unique search ability to retrieve clips based on data such as time and date.

The latest release of ACTi MobileGo! fixes the search issues experienced in older versions and can be found at the iTunes App Store.

Before using the MobileGo! application, users will want to ensure that they have previously downloaded and installed ACTi NVR 2.2 or later with ACTi Mobile Server into their surveillance system server.

 

ACTi Announces Alliance with WiseDV

Thursday, May 12th, 2011

Global frontrunners in the IP surveillance solution field, ACTi Corporation, is creating alliances all over the world. Their recent partnership to WiseDV (a privately traded corporation headquartered in San Diego, with locations in England and India) comes from ACTi’s desire to bolster the WiseDV PC software WiseCast to offer live streaming capabilities from ACTi IP cameras to both iPad and iPhone.

Of the recent partnership between their two organizations, Atul Anandpura (CEO of WiseDV) said, “WiseDV appreciates quality and reliability of ACTi camera. ACTi cameras are one of the leading camera WiseDV uses to demonstrate WiseDV technology. WiseDV appreciate ACTi’s technical support’s quality and timeliness.”

The joining of the two organizations means that there is no longer a need for ACTi IP camera users to configure their megapixel cameras in MJPEG mode in order to monitor the cameras on a mobile device.

 

HeiTel and ACTi Form Partnership for Advanced IP Surveillance

Tuesday, May 10th, 2011

In recent news, ACTi has announced the successful amalgamation of their popular camera lineup with leading German manufacturers of solutions for remote video monitoring, HeiTel Digital Video GmbH. The news comes after HeiTel Digital Video verified that they had been successful  merging ACTi IP cameras with the HeiTel Video Gateway-series, and are now fully supporting at ‘IP products up to Megapixel resolution.’

The new partnership alliance between ACTi and HeiTel is likely to bring forth many new advancements to the security and IP surveillance sectors. In fact, alarm and control centers currently taking advantage of HeiTel alarm monitoring software have already reported significant advantages from the merger and are benefiting greatly from the superior image quality generated by the new ACTi IP cameras.

ACTi Corp. Announces the TCM-4101

Thursday, January 21st, 2010

ACTi

ACTi has recently announced via a press release that the TCM-4101 is now available. The ACTi TCM-4101 is a Triple Codec cube style network camera that support MPEG4, MJPEG and H.264 video compression and will allow for up to two simultaneous video feeds to be broadcast at the same time. The TCM-4101 supports VGA video resolutions and will allow for up to 30 frames per second of full motion video. Additional features of the ACTi TCM-4101 include Two-Way audio communication support as well as built-in support for PoE (Power over Ethernet). With the inclusion of PoE support, installation of the TCM-4101 is both easy and more cost effective by allowing for the camera to receive power on the same Ethernet cable line that video data also propagates on.

ACTi has listed the TCM-4101 as suitable for small business applications including a retail shops where a compact, full featured and affordable network video solution is desired. The ACTi TCM-4101 meets these requirements through product innovation, by including network video surveillance software, and by remaining affordable to general consumers and small business owners alike. ACTi Releases New Mobile Explorer

Tuesday, January 19th, 2010

ACTi

ACTi has recently announced that a new version of the ACTi Mobile Explorer software is now available. The ACTi Mobile Explorer software is designed to allow you to view video feeds produced by ACTi network video devices and network video recording software on a PDA device. This latest software release, version 2.1.10, adds support for viewing megapixel IP camera devices through the ACTi NVR software, allows for the video streams to be resized based on user configuration and also adds support for Two-Way audio communication. The ACTi Mobile Explorer software is a great application for PDA users who require access to their IP video surveillance network by providing mobile client access. With mobile access you then have the ability to check in on your surveillance network from almost any remote location providing your PDA device has the ability to connect to the surveillance network. World’s Largest Steel Maker Protected by ACTi Network Video Surveillance

Thursday, January 14th, 2010

ACTi

The world’s largest steel maker, Arcelor Mittal, has installed a security system by SC Electro Universe SCM that utilizes ACTi network video surveillance products. Arcelor Mittal, based in Romania, holds the largest tubular factory in the world. The entire video surveillance system in managed from a centralized location and consists of ACTi IP camera and video server devices. The ACTi ACD-2200 and SED-2140T video server devices, along with the ACTi ACM-1431P bullet IP camera were chosen for installation with connection to a centralized management server. Video data is transmitted across the network via a fiber optic network with a total network length of approximately 10 kilometers. Wireless technology has also been utilized to help connect some of the IP camera video feeds into the surveillance network.

The application features areas with extreme temperature variations with temperatures ranging from -30 degrees Celsius in the winter to 60 degrees Celsius in the summer. Due to the extreme range in temperatures the ACTi SED-2140T was used in these specific areas. The SED-2140T is a temperature resistant video server designed specifically with these types of environments in mind.

ACTi Press Release Excerpt:
Manager from SC Electro Universe SCM has mentioned that, when selecting video servers for this project, we have tested many brands in the market and finally chose ACTi solutions, ”It is the State of ART” Technical Director Daniel said. Because of the excellent performance of ACTI equipments in very low lighting conditions and very reasonable price.
